Job Description
Reporting to the Director of Outlets, responsibilities and essential job functions include but are not limited to the following:
Consistently offer professional, friendly and engaging service
Lead the Restaurant team in all aspects and ensure service standards are followed
Ensure smooth day to day operations of restaurant. . Foster and promote a strong work culture, and uphold service standards.
Coach, guide and support team to provide exceptional guest experience.
Provide ongoing feedback, establish performance expectations and conduct performance reviews.
Handle guest concerns and react quickly and professionally
Assist in recruiting and training all Outlet Colleagues
Balance operational, administrative and Colleague needs
Attend regularly scheduled departmental meetings
Communicate effectively and thoroughly with all stakeholders.
Maximize revenues by communicating regularly with the Food and Beverage teams to implement agreed upon strategies, practices and promotions
Track sales against budget/forecast, execute strategies for increasing sales, while maintaining constant communication with the team. Manage and track voids, discounts and any financial inconsistencies.
Monitor guest count and communicate with BOH and FOH teams to ensure a smooth shift.
Meet financial goals, such as but not limited to: labor cost, food cost, profit margin, etc.
Have full knowledge of all Outlet menus
Assist with payroll and scheduling. Anticipate schedule changes based on Restaurant needs and seasonality, and ensure all staffing needs are met while meeting the budget. Manage attendance.
Maintain legal compliance with all relevant EEO, labor, collective bargaining agreement, T&C, wage and food safety laws and regulations.
Comply and enforce DOH regulations and Company standards when performing cleaning tasks, preparing food and beverages. . Follow and lead company dress code and hygiene practices and standards.
Assist in managing the departmental budget
Follow outlet policies, procedures and service standards
Follow all safety and sanitation policies when handling food and beverage
Other duties as assigned
